About the Museum
The Moore Methodist Museum, the Ministry of Memory of the South Georgia Conference of the United Methodist Church, welcomes visitors to explore the history of the Methodist movement and its founder John Wesley. Exhibits feature the development and leaders of Methodism in America, Epworth By The Sea and St. Simons Island history, and much more. The Museum plays the full-length documentary "St. Simons 360: Historical Video Tour" twice daily and presents the "John Wesley on St. Simons" lecture given by Rev. Dave Hanson every Thursday at 11:00 am. The Museum houses an extensive nativity collection including the O Holy Night Exhibit made up of life-sized, paper-mache nativity scenes. A lending library and Christian Bookstore/Gift Shop are also onsite. Museum hours are Monday - Friday from 10:00 am to 4:00 pm and Saturday from 1 pm to 4 pm. We are closed on Sundays and major holidays. Call 912-638-4050 to schedule a guided tour. Group tours are available. There is no admission fee but donations are gratefully accepted.
Susan Duke Waters, artist and Methodist from Rockmart, Georgia, created this stunning exhibit entitled O Holy Night featuring life-sized, papier-mache nativity scenes. From the journey to Bethlehem to Jesus's birth in the manger, experience this stunning artistic creation.
Stand in amazement with the shepherds at the angels heralding the new king's birth and travel with the wise men as they follow the foretold star. This is a new, permanent exhibit on display at the Moore Methodist Museum
STORY MOORE
New Program Announced
The mission of Story Moore is to collect and preserve the stories of Methodists living in the South Georgia Conference to build connections between people in order to make disciples for Jesus Christ and for the transformation of the world. The interview session is at the heart of Story Moore acknowledging that everyone's story matters and reminding people of the value of listening. A Story Moore interview is 40 minutes of uninterrupted time for meaningful conversation with a friend or loved one. At the heart of a great conversation are people connecting and sharing and we have tips to help facilitate meaningful dialogue.
